It is classified as an endometrial cancer that ordinarily starts in the layers of cells that type the lining of the uterus. Endometrial cancer can typically be discovered early on because it produces abnormal vaginal bleeding. If a uterine cancer is found early on, it can normally be cured by surgically removing the uterus. In addition to abnormal vaginal bleeding, there are a quantity of signs that girls ought to look for which could point to uterine cancer.

L’Oréal is the #1 worldwide Beauty company by sales, involved in just about every segment and region. It generates 39.eight% of its EBIT from L’Oréal Luxe and 34.eight% from Customer Products. Europe is its largest region, with 31.five% of sales, followed by North Asia (30.five%) and North America (25.3%). Shares purchased in registered kind, as well as employee shareholding fund units, will be blocked for a five-year period, subject to early release exceptions defined by applicable regulations in France and the other countries in which the give is produced readily available. Beneficiaries will have the possibility to obtain L’Oréal shares in a “classic” subscription formula, exactly where the worth of their investment will differ with alterations in the L’Oréal share price. They will also benefit from an employer contribution, subject to the terms and circumstances described in the strategy documentation.

The executive was inside L’Oréal USA’s new West Coast hub — marking the company’s very first headquarters outside New York City. Officially opened on Aug. 23 at 888 North Douglas Street in El Segundo, Calif., the space unites NYX Specialist Makeup, Urban Decay, Pulp Riot and Youth to the Folks beneath 1 roof.
Driven by gains in all categories and channels, L’Oréal’s 2021 sales rose 15.3% to $36.eight billion. By division, professional solution sales rose 22.2% customer items increased 4.5% L’Oréal Luxe jumped 21.9% and Active Cosmetics soared 30.three%.
